SIR-We hear about corruption being levelled against workers, some of whom have been brought to justice. I would say people are becoming corrupt because they are worried about their destiny. Job security in the government service is not certain; yet it should be guaranteed for all workers. Those retrenched should be given Entandikwa for business or life after retrenchment. This would help motivate their talent at jobs. If 300 police officers are to be sacked as indicated in recent press reports, their children should be guaranteed free education and their parents given Entandikwa.
